Andhra Pradesh Polytechnic Common Entrance Test (AP PolyCET) is a state-level exam conducted by the State Board of Technical Education and Training (SBTET), Andhra Pradesh, Hyderabad. The State Board of Technical Education and Training in Andhra Pradesh, which is located in Vijayawada, will be organizing a test called the Polytechnic Common Entrance Test (POLYCET). This test is for students who want to join diploma courses in fields like engineering, non-engineering, and technology.

Candidates who successfully pass the exam will secure admission to various polytechnic institutions, including both aided and unaided private polytechnics, as well as institutions within private engineering colleges throughout Andhra Pradesh.

AP PolyCET 2025 Eligibility Criteria 

To participate in AP POLYCET 2025, candidates must meet specific eligibility requirements. These include citizenship of India, domicile in Andhra Pradesh, and qualification of the 10th class or equivalent from recognized boards. There’s no age limit, and candidates appearing in the 2025 examinations are also eligible to apply.

  • Nationality: Candidates must be citizens of India.
  • Domicile: Applicants must belong to Andhra Pradesh state.
  • Qualification: Candidates should have passed the 10th class or its equivalent from the State Board of Secondary Education, Andhra Pradesh, or any board recognized by the Board of Secondary Education, AP/TS.
  • Age Limit: There is no age limit for the AP POLYCET 2025 exam.
  • Minimum Marks: Candidates must obtain a minimum of 35% marks in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ry subjects in the qualifying examination.
  • Appearing Candidates: Those appearing in the 2025 examination are also eligible to apply for the AP POLYCET exam.

AP PolyCET 2025 Exam Pattern 

Get acquainted with the exam structure for AP POLYCET 2025, where the assessment will be conducted offline, featuring 120 multiple-choice questions. Candidates will have 2 hours to complete the paper, with each correct answer earning them 1 mark, and no negative marking for incorrect responses.

  • Exam Mode: Offline mode (pen and paper-based).
  • Duration: The exam will be for 2 hours.
  • Type of Questions: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s).
  • Total Questions: 120 questions will be there in the paper.
  • Marking Scheme: Candidates will receive 1 mark for each correct answer, and there will be no negative marking for wrong answers.

Mark Distribution:

SubjectsMarks
Physics40
Chemistry30
Mathematics50

AP PolyCET 2025 Syllabus 

The AP POLYCET syllabus encompasses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ics subjects, meticulously outlined by the Board of Secondary Education, Andhra Pradesh. Covering a broad spectrum of topics, it provides a comprehensive framework for aspirants preparing for the examination.

SubjectTopics
PhysicsUnits and Dimensions, Work, Power, and Energy, Elements of Vectors, Heat and Thermodynamics, Kinematics and Friction, Simple Harmonic Motion and Acoustics, Reflection of Light, Refraction of Light at Plane Surfaces, Modern Physics
ChemistryAtomic Structure, Chemical Bonding, Water Technology Solutions, Fuels, Electrochemistry, Acids and Bases, Corrosion, Polymers
MathematicsNumber System, Real Numbers, Linear Equations, Polynomials, Algebra, Quadratic Equations, Trigonometry, Sets, Geometry, Coordinate Geometry, Surface Areas & Volume, Mathematical Modelling, Probability

AP POLYCET 2025 Reservation Criteria

For admission to non-minority institutions, AP POLYCET follows a reservation system allocating seats based on specific criteria, ensuring equitable opportunities for candidates from various categories.

CategoryReservation Criteria
Open Competition50%
Scheduled Caste (SC)15%
Scheduled Tribe (ST)6%
BC (Backward Class)29%
Physically Handicapped (PH)3%
Children of Armed Personnel2%
